Description: Burghound 93 Sweet Spot, Outstanding. "Here the toasty and menthol-inflected nose is slightly more deeply pitched with attractively spiced aromas that include iron-infused warm earth notes as well as animale and underbrush hints. The succulent yet overtly powerful big-bodied flavors are blessed with ample dry extract that coats the palate on the very firm, concentrated and driving finish where a touch of warmth arises. There is real energy here and while the tannins are notably prominent at the moment, this is actually fairly refined for a young Mazis." John Gilman 96+ "The only thing I might have done differently from Philippe Harmand with this magnificent Mazis-Chambertin is I might have used a bit less new wood, just to allow the terroir here to shine through even brighter, as Philippe raised this wine in ninety percent new wood this year. It is not that the oak is in the way at all, as it is seamlessly integrated into this beautiful wine, but I would just be curious to see what this great wine might have looked like with less new wood. In any case, this wine is utterly stunning, as it offers up a truly superb aromatic constellation of red and black plums, sappy black cherries, roasted meats, raw cocoa, a very complex base of minerality, a touch of hazelnut and a base of smoky new wood. On the palate the wine is deep, full-bodied and simply rippling with energy, with tangy acids, ripe tannins, a very sappy core and laser-like focus on the pure and very complex finish. This will be a very, very elegant and sappy example of Mazis at its apogee." Wine Advocate (William Kelley) 95 "The 2015 Mazis-Chambertin Grand Cru is superb, offering up a classic bouquet of wild berries, cherry, grilled game, subtle mint and a framing of smoky new oak. On the palate, the wine is full-bodied and concentrated, with true grand cru depth and dimension, its tannins fine-grained and its finish long and penetrating. This is a powerful Mazis-Chambertin that retains excellent energy and freshness despite its considerable volume, and which could compete with some of Gevrey's finest." Importer Neal Rosenthal "Harmand-Geoffroy exploits over three quarters of a hectare in this great vineyard that lies just north of Clos de Beze and just below Ruchottes-Chambertin on the prime fillet of Gevrey-Chambertin grand cru turf. Produced from vines between 45 and 75 years of age, the Mazis-Chambertin is always the firmest and most youthfully reticent wine in the cellar. This 2015 is positively explosive, brimming with spices both musky and fresh, and offering a kirsch-like core of fruit that completely coats the immense tannins lurking below the surface. The palate unfolds slowly and regally, with great persistence and an underlying sense of energy that speaks to both the quality of the vintage and the skill with which Harmand rendered it."
